However, the trajectory of these sectors is not without friction. The flow of investment required to sustain these emerging industries is immense. Governments are increasingly intervening with subsidies and tax incentives to ensure domestic competitiveness. In the United States, the CHIPS Act aims to bolster semiconductor manufacturing, recognizing that digital sovereignty is linked to economic security. Similarly, China’s five-year plans prioritize self-sufficiency in core technologies. This state-led capitalism introduces complex market trends where geopolitics influences supply chains. Investors must navigate not only commercial risks but also regulatory landscapes that shift with diplomatic tensions.

Financial markets are reacting to these structural changes. Stock indices are increasingly weighted toward tech and green energy firms, while traditional conglomerates face pressure to diversify. Analysts warn that valuation models need adjustment. Traditional metrics like price-to-earnings ratios sometimes fail to capture the potential of pre-profit emerging industries that are prioritizing market share and R&D over immediate returns. This shift in investor mindset fuels the capital needed for experimentation but also introduces volatility. The promise of high returns attracts speculative bubbles, requiring careful oversight to ensure that investment remains grounded in viable business models rather than hype.
Regulatory frameworks are struggling to keep pace with the speed of innovation. Data privacy, algorithmic bias, and carbon credit verification are all areas where laws are playing catch-up. Uncertainty in regulation can dampen investor confidence. For sustainable development to truly drive growth, there must be standardized metrics for what constitutes “green.” Without consensus, there is a risk of greenwashing, where funds are diverted to projects with minimal environmental impact. Clear guidelines would reduce risk premiums and encourage more stable, long-term capital allocation. The interplay between regulation and market freedom will define the efficiency of these new sectors.
